What is Sheet Metal Fabrication?

Sheet metal fabrication is the process of transforming flat metal sheets into functional components or structures through cutting, bending, and assembling techniques.

It involves various metals such as:

  • Steel
  • Stainless steel
  • Aluminum
  • Brass

This process is widely used to create:

  • Industrial equipment
  • Furniture
  • Electrical enclosures
  • Automotive parts

In simple terms, it converts raw metal sheets into customized, usable products.

Sheet Metal Fabrication Process (Step-by-Step)

Understanding the fabrication process helps businesses evaluate quality and expertise.

1. Design & Engineering

The process begins with CAD (Computer-Aided Design) drawings. These define:

  • Dimensions
  • Tolerances
  • Material specifications

2. Cutting

Metal sheets are cut into required shapes using:

  • Laser cutting
  • Plasma cutting
  • Waterjet cutting

3. Bending & Forming

Machines like press brakes are used to bend metal into desired shapes.

4. Welding & Assembly

Different parts are joined together using welding or fastening techniques.

5. Finishing

Final touches include:

  • Powder coating
  • Polishing
  • Painting
  • Surface treatment

Each step ensures precision, strength, and durability.

Industrial Applications of Sheet Metal Fabrication

Sheet metal fabrication is used across multiple industries:

Manufacturing Industry

  • Machine components
  • Industrial storage systems
  • Conveyor systems

Commercial Sector

  • Office furniture
  • Retail display units
  • Storage racks

Electrical & Electronics

  • Control panels
  • Server racks
  • IT enclosures

Healthcare Industry

  • Hospital furniture
  • Medical equipment frames

Automotive Industry

  • Vehicle body parts
  • Structural components

Its versatility makes it essential for both small businesses and large-scale industries.
